There has to be an approved fix as we have members that already got the recall completed and uploaded pictures of the replacement parts. It's likely the level of information trickling down to the individual service departments are not the same.
I also called my local dealer and they're aware of this recall, but do not have the parts yet. Supposedly, they're going to "expedite" my order and call me when it's in. I'm not holding my breadth that'll happen. Give it some time and wait for your official letter from BMW. There may be some peace of mind knowing that the danger of the current B pillar design likely only affects passengers in the back seat. If you rarely have rear passengers, it shouldn't be a big deal. If you do have folks in the back seat, make sure they have their seat belt on. |

just called my dealer (NorCa). This dealer is almost done fixing all the new (2019) cars - new car VINs got prioritized for b-pillar parts. They're then going to move on to used cars (CPO + used).

Unlikely, as the fix is to replace a small plastic trim piece in the B pillar, the post between the driver and rear passenger window. As I was told by the dealer, a 5 minute fix.
